How Do UV Lights Work to Purify Air

HVAC UV lights are installed inside your ductwork or air handler, typically positioned near the evaporator coil where moisture tends to collect. As air passes through the system, the UV-C light neutralizes mold spores, bacteria, and viruses by disrupting their DNA, preventing them from reproducing and spreading through your ducts.

This matters most at the coil itself, since evaporator coils stay damp during normal operation and are among the most common places where mold takes hold in a home’s HVAC system. A UV light installed at this location keeps the coil cleaner over time, which also helps your system maintain better airflow and operate more efficiently. Unlike air filters, which only trap particles that pass through them, UV lights actively target the organisms growing directly on your equipment.

Signs Your Home Would Benefit From UV Lights

Not every home needs UV light installation, but certain conditions make it a smart investment. Here’s what to look for.

  • Musty odor from the vents
  • Visible mold on the coil
  • Frequent allergy or asthma symptoms
  • High indoor humidity levels
  • Home with limited natural ventilation
  • Family members with respiratory sensitivities
  • Recent water damage or flooding
  • Older ductwork with a buildup history

UV Light Installation

Installation starts with our technicians evaluating your air handler and ductwork to determine the best placement for the UV light, since positioning affects how well it targets the coil and airflow path. Most systems use a coil-mounted UV light that runs continuously, though some homes benefit from an air-stream configuration that treats a larger volume of passing air.

Once we’ve identified the right setup, HVAC UV light installation typically takes under two hours and doesn’t require any modification to your existing ductwork. Our team wires the unit to a safe power source, tests it to confirm proper operation, and walks you through the expected bulb lifespan, as most UV bulbs need replacement every 12 to 24 months to remain effective. We’ll also flag it during future maintenance visits, so you’re never caught off guard by a bulb that’s quietly stopped working.
